From Angels and Ancestors Pocket Oracle by Kyle Gray


Water Guardian: Connect with your emotions

Perhaps it’s the geomagnetic storms lately, but it has already been an emotional couple of days leading up to this week. Whatever you are feeling, acknowledge it. Don’t hide it or shove it to the background. Run a nice warm bath, get a cup or tea or glass of wine, relax and allow yourself to feel through these emotions. Don’t hide from “negative” emotions. Let yourself cry, it’s good to feel what you feel. There really are no “negative” or “positive” emotions, emotions just are. They, in and of themselves, are neutral and a good indicator of what you need at any given moment. So take a moment to feel what you feel, acknowledge the source, and allow yourself to heal. So have that ugly cry if you feel it. Tears are soul cleansing and you’ll be glad once it’s over as you will feel lighter and better for it. If it’s joy that you’re feeling, that’s awesome! Go out and play and spread your joy like glitter. Even anger is a catalyst for a much needed change. Anger, when used wisely, can be inspiring. Embrace your emotions without judgement. 


From The Wild Unknown Tarot by Kim Krans


Energy of the Week: 3 of Swords

Right in line with the Water Guardian, there is truth and an emotional release in store for you this week. The truth, no matter how painful, will set you free. Feel what you feel, have that ugly cry. You may be feeling rather raw once it’s all said and done, but you are now healing. Release what needs to be released and cleanse your soul. 


Challenge: Daughter of Wands

While moving through all of the emotions of this week, your greatest challenge will be regaining your confidence. You are, by nature, a free spirit and there is no need to hold yourself back, emotionally or otherwise. Once you strip down to the bare emotions and release them, it’s time to reconnect with your authenticity. 


Focus: The Empress

Focus on self care. Nurture yourself through this process of growth. Every challenge is an opportunity to grow. Stripped down to the bare bones, now you can rediscover who you are and who you want to be moving forward. As we move into February and gearing up for the Horse to follow the Snake, you are shedding the last bits of the old you this week. It’s time for your rebirth. 


What Does It All Mean for You?


Don't worry about emotions being negative or positive or high vibrational or low vibrational. You are here for a human experience and that means experiencing emotions as they are. Without judgement. Give yourself some grace to feel what you feel so you can release and heal what you are meant to in order to understand yourself on a deeper level and grow. Every emotion has it's purpose, so don't ignore it or hide it. Explore it without fear and embrace your authentic self.
